Everything You Need To Know About The Ball Valve PTFE Seat
When it comes to industrial processes that involve the regulation of fluids, having reliable valves is crucial One type of valve that is commonly used in various industries is the ball valve Ball valves are known for their durability, reliability, and ease of operation One key component of a ball valve that ensures its proper functioning is the PTFE seat.
PTFE, also known as polytetrafluoroethylene, is a synthetic polymer that is commonly used in valve seats due to its unique properties PTFE is chemically inert, has low friction, excellent heat resistance, and is non-stick These properties make it ideal for use in applications where chemical compatibility, high temperatures, and low friction are critical.
The PTFE seat in a ball valve plays a crucial role in ensuring a tight seal, preventing leakage, and facilitating smooth operation The seat is positioned between the ball and the valve body and provides a seal when the valve is closed When the valve is opened, the PTFE seat allows the ball to rotate freely, controlling the flow of fluids through the valve.
There are several advantages of using a ball valve with a PTFE seat One of the main benefits is the excellent chemical resistance of PTFE This makes PTFE seats suitable for use in a wide range of applications, including corrosive environments where other materials may fail ball valve ptfe seat. PTFE is also resistant to high temperatures, making it ideal for applications where extreme heat is a factor.
Another advantage of using a ball valve with a PTFE seat is its low friction properties The smooth surface of PTFE reduces wear and tear on the valve components, resulting in longer service life and reduced maintenance costs The low friction also allows for easy operation of the valve, even under high pressure or temperature conditions.
In addition to chemical resistance and low friction, PTFE is also known for its non-stick properties This means that the PTFE seat resists build-up of debris, chemicals, or other contaminants, leading to a cleaner and more reliable valve operation The non-stick properties of PTFE also make it easy to clean and maintain, ensuring long-term performance of the valve.
When selecting a ball valve with a PTFE seat, it is important to consider the specific requirements of your application Factors such as pressure rating, temperature range, fluid compatibility, and flow rate should be taken into account to ensure that the valve will perform optimally in your system It is also important to choose a reputable manufacturer that uses high-quality PTFE materials and precision machining techniques to ensure the reliability and longevity of the valve.
